# 如何实现“python post不验证ssl” ## 一、流程表格 | 步骤 | 操作 | | ------ | ------ | | 1 | 导入必要的模块 | | 2 | 创建一个会话对象 | | 3 | 禁用ssl验证 | | 4 | 发送post请求 | ## 二、具体操作步骤 ### 1. 导入必要的模块 首先,你需要导入`requests`模块,这个模块可以帮助你发送htt
原创 2024-04-08 04:45:35
373阅读
# Python Post请求绕过SSL实现流程 ## 介绍 在网络通信中,SSL(Secure Socket Layer)是一种保证数据传输安全的协议。然而,在某些情况下,我们可能需要绕过SSL,这篇文章将教会你如何通过Python进行Post请求绕过SSL。 ## 步骤 下面是实现该过程的步骤流程: | 步骤 | 操作 | | ---- | ---- | | 步骤1 | 导入所需的库 |
原创 2023-12-31 08:12:20
267阅读
openssl,ssl,postgres 网络传输安全默认情况下pg服务端和客户端之间的数据传输是明文传输,有一定的安全隐患。pg中可以使用ssl进行安全的tcp/ip连接,以密文的形式进行数据的安全传输。这个特性要求在客户端和服务器都安装OpenSSL,并且在编译pg的时候打开这个支持,使用openssl指令生成私钥和证书,用来对数据加解密注意在编译安
转载 2024-06-08 14:08:48
144阅读
# 使用Java实现SSL POST请求的科普 在现代网络应用中,安全性是不可忽视的重要问题。尤其是在数据传输的过程中,确保数据在传输过程中不被第三方截取或篡改是一项基本要求。SSL(安全套接层)和TLS(传输层安全)是保障互联网通信安全的两种主要协议。本文将详细介绍如何使用Java实现SSL POST请求,带你逐步理解其工作原理和实际应用。 ## SSL/TLS简介 SSL/TLS协议通过
原创 7月前
21阅读
在进行Python爬虫任务时,遇到SSL证书验证错误是常见的问题之一。SSL证书验证是为了确保与服务器建立的连接是安全和可信的,但有时候可能会由于证书过期、不匹配或未受信任等原因导致验证失败。为了解决这个问题,本文将提供一些实用的解决办法,并给出相关的代码示例,希望对爬虫任务有所帮助。一、了解SSL证书验证错误SSL证书验证错误通常是指爬虫在使用HTTPS请求时,由于服务器证书无效或不可信任,导致
转载 2024-10-17 07:33:07
119阅读
   考虑以下两个示例,它们具有相同的作用: 示例1(单元测试): import unittest class LearningCase(unittest.TestCase): def test_starting_out(self): self.assertEqual(1, 1) def main(): unittest.main() i
# Java实现POST SSL 在网络通信中,保证数据传输的安全性是非常重要的。其中,SSL(Secure Sockets Layer)协议是一种常用的加密通信协议,用于确保数据在客户端和服务器之间的安全传输。在Java中,可以使用HttpsURLConnection类实现POST请求并使用SSL协议进行加密通信。 ## 实现步骤 1. 创建SSLContext对象,并加载证书 ```j
原创 2024-02-24 03:35:42
99阅读
JavaWeb项目部署服务器并配置ssl证书教程相信大家学了1.2年的编程后可能已经学会了自己写web项目,但是也只能在自己本地玩耍,十分的打击学习热情(主要是没办法跟朋友装杯)。本文是一篇较为详细的从配置服务器开始的web项目部署教程。准备工作:一个服务器(本文采用阿里云的轻量型服务器)一个可以在本地运行的javaweb项目(本文采用ssm+mysql项目)一双手(en。。。)部署流程: 购买服
转载 2024-05-09 09:45:05
101阅读
前言:在开发web应用程序时,登录模块是经常使用到的一个模块。然而,对于一个登录请求,我们应该使用哪种HTTP方法呢?是使用POST还是GET呢?本篇文章将会给出答案。POST和GET:在web开发中,HTTP协议有两种常见的请求方法:GET和POST。两种请求方法的主要区别有以下三点。1. 参数传递方式不同:GET方法:数据会附加在URL的后面,以?key1=value1&key2=va
转载 2024-04-02 14:50:01
36阅读
# Java国密SSLPost请求 在Java中进行网络请求时,我们经常会使用到SSL来加密通信,保护数据的安全性。而在中国,为了保证国内数据的安全,国密算法被广泛应用于网络安全领域。本篇文章将介绍如何在Java中使用国密SSL进行Post请求,实现数据的安全传输。 ## 国密SSLPost请求 在进行Post请求时,我们通常会使用HttpURLConnection或HttpClient
原创 2024-06-04 06:17:16
193阅读
在请求后面添加ignoreSslErrors:true即可
原创 2022-06-28 18:33:21
146阅读
Tomcat+OpenSSL配置单向认证(自制证书)我使用的方法是openssl+keytool一起使用来配置单向认证证书进入openssl安装文件夹 在其下建立ca,client,server文件夹,为了创建三种证书  进入bin文件夹,打开openssl.exe文件制作根证书1. 建立根证书密钥文件root.key openssl genrsa -des3 -ou
转载 2023-08-02 13:25:20
114阅读
GmSSL 是一个开源(遵循 BSD 协议)的密码工具箱,支持 SM2 / SM3 / SM4 / SM9 / ZUC 等国密(国家商用密码)算法、SM2 国密数字证书及基于 SM2 证书的 SSL / TLS 安全通信协议,支持国密硬件密码设备,提供符合国密规范的编程接口与命令行工具,可以用于构建 PKI / CA 、安全通信、数据加密等符合国密标准的安全应用。GmSSL 项目是 OpenSSL
转载 2023-08-24 13:27:34
1145阅读
安装Python3.6.41 安装python3.6可能使用的依赖yum install openssl-devel bzip2-devel expat-devel gdbm-devel readline-devel sqlite-devel gcc gcc-c++ openssl-devel libffi-devel2 到python官网找到下载路径, 用wget下载wget https://
转载 2023-06-30 12:07:37
712阅读
Python 提供了两个级别访问的网络服务。: 低级别的网络服务支持基本的 Socket,它提供了标准的 BSD Sockets API,可以访问底层操作系统Socket接口的全部方法。 高级别的网络服务模块 SocketServer, 它提供了服务器中心类,可以简化网络服务器的开发。什么是 Socket? Socket又称”套接字”,应用程序通常通过”套接字”向网络发出请求或者应答网络请求
环境介绍Centos 7, python 3问题描述pip3 install numpy输出信息如下:pip is configured with locations that require TLS/SSL, however the ssl module in Python is not available. Collecting numpy Could not fetch URL http
转载 2023-05-26 20:28:26
102阅读
session处理部分接口需要先登录网址,才能有权限进行调用,这时可以使用到session,具体操作是:先使用网站 的登录api进行登录,得到session后,然后用该session来请求其它的接口。示例代码:session_obj = requests.session() # 用来保持会话连接,后面的请求都用session对象来发送 import requests,re # 2、完成php
转载 2023-10-24 21:38:34
90阅读
简单邮件传输协议(SMTP)是一种协议,用于在邮件服务器之间发送电子邮件和路由电子邮件。Python提供smtplib模块,该模块定义了一个SMTP客户端会话对象,可用于使用SMTP或ESMTP侦听器守护程序向任何互联网机器发送邮件。SMTP通讯的基本流程可以概括为以下几点:1.连接SMTP服务器2.登陆用户名和密码3.发送指定邮件内容4.退出SMTP连接一、最简单案例1.获取授权码(充当登录密码
转载 2023-11-25 14:27:03
264阅读
传输层安全协议(TLS)算是如今互联网上应用最广泛的加密方法。TLS的前身是安全套接层(SSL),现代互联网的许多协议基础协议都是使用TLS来验证服务器身份,并保护传输过程中的数据。TLS能保护的信息包括:与请求URL之间的HTTPS链接以及以及返回内容、密码或cookie等可能在套接字双向传递的认证信息。下面的信息无法使用TLS保护:本机与远程主机都是可见的,地址信息在每个数据包的IP头信息中以
本文介绍了JDK8调用HTTPS接口的SSL配置方案。针对JDK8特性,重点说明只支持TLSv1.2的限制,提供了创建信任所有证书的SSL上下文(测试环境)和加载信任库(生产环境)两种实现方式,包含完整的HTTP客户端配置代码。文中还给出了密码套件定制、系统属性设置等可选配置项,并提供了证书验证失败、协议版本不匹配等常见问题的解决方案。最后建议生产环境使用更安全的信任库配置,并提供了启用SSL调试的方法。
转载 12天前
340阅读
  • 1
  • 2
  • 3
  • 4
  • 5